And then 100% is 100% so you can still do flight control checks, etc. Rather flatten the “curve” (linear, straight line) from 0% to (say) 90% input results in 0% to (say) 60% output (or whatever range makes sense for “normal” flight envelope deflections). If you want to have more “precision“ in the controls (and a lot of this comes down to the hardware one uses), one suggestion is setting up a custom response curve so that the (for example) 90% position of your hardware isn’t the 90% position of the sim controls. I’m not 100% sure they’d have any effect on the CL-650, but any effect may well be changing the flight model to be something not what the developer intended.
